Output 252d6bc33f5f85a346662a20b8d12eb1ef4aa65a7ceb08a789fb4c4483c0d9e7:14

value
28991040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a31e699f141123ca5cfde61417710003042948 OP_EQUAL
address
3N5W21p2Tro14d2CHYFvrxShp2AibFkxjQ
transaction
252d6bc33f5f85a346662a20b8d12eb1ef4aa65a7ceb08a789fb4c4483c0d9e7
spent
true